Plant to move the tree three months before the onset of long rains. Start digging the area around the tree and use the crown diameter to determine the width of your hole. Expose as many roots as possible but avoid cutting them. Most importantly, preserve the tap root that gives it stability.

Start tying the ball with bags as you go down. Eventually, you will have dug the area around it and will now be approaching the tap root. Instead of cutting the main root, dig around it and hoist a crane with chains ensuring that you tie the strong branches and twigs to keep it as vertical as possible. This will prevent it from falling in the event of a strong wind that may cause instability.

Leave the crane for three months at the hole to enable the plant to acclimatize to the new conditions. Keep watering and feeding it with phosphate and nitrogen fertilizers. After three months, you are now ready to move it to the new location. Ask your driver to be gentle to avoid shaking the ball too much as this may result to disintegration.

Place it on the new location and back fill the soil. The rains should come any time and you will have accomplished an exciting exercise to remember.

Another challenge comes when you want to build a deck and a couple of mature vegetation surrounds your house. While many people would rush to cut them down, you can be more creative and build it around them. Your new deck will look exciting as long as you can hoist it well above the ground to avoid drainage problems. If you want the deck to be panoramic, you can avoid wooden balustrades and go for strong wires, cables or even glass.
